Exactly How to Achieve Shielding in CUSTOM IRON ON PATCHES<br>

27.5.2021


Obtaining a realistic 3-D embroidered picture calls for understanding the physics of art, which is the basis of the interaction in between color blending as well as shading.<br>
Although the terms "blending" and "shading" commonly are interchanged, there is a difference. You can blend colors without shielding, yet you can not color an item without mixing colors. Last month, I gave information on blending with thread (see "The Art of Successful Color Blending," March 2013). Let's go a step even more by looking at the blending technique and also applying it to shading a things.<br>
Comparable to mixing, shading entails moving gradually from one shade to another, which implies use the color wheel is called for. Through our application of stitches, we also will certainly deal with the physical buildings that regulate our art. For example, you can not put a stitch on top of another stitch. When put on top of each other, two teams of fill stitches going in the very same direction will certainly blend as well as the product, CUSTOM IRON ON PATCHES, may look negative.<br>
We will once again utilize the light density fill that we utilized for blending in last month's article. You will lighten your density to one-third of the default worth. As an example, if you have 1,500 stitches in a square inch of fill, you will certainly minimize that amount to 500 stitches. By placing 3 layers of that fill in the same location, you will certainly have 100% density. By having the fills perform at the very same angle, ideally flat, you can mix colors and shade things.<br>
Let's look at 2 various tinted things and also take a look at the shading procedure used with both.<br>
BLACK & WHITE SHADING<br>
In blending, the transition from dark to light provides objects realism and depth. Darker shades decline, while lighter shades show up ahead onward. Therefore, when shielding items, you will certainly make use of darker colors around the outside as well as lighter shades in the center.<br>
<br>
Checking out the ball in Figure 1 (see affixed image gallery), you will certainly see the really dark shades-- or darkness-- around the side and the extremely light shades-- or full light-- in the center. Between the two are halftones, a combination of the light and also the dark shades, and also a steady change between the shades made use of. Likewise, notification there is a mild difference in the amount of the dark shade on the top of the round than under. This is determined by where the light hits the things.<br>
For the very same effect using string, you should mix light as well as dark colors, while adding a third color to reveal a gradual transition. Start with a darker string shade on the outer edges of the circle. Place one layer of the light density fill in the darkest area, after that do a second layer that covers the initial layer and prolongs into the lighter center. After that, lay out the whole round (Figure 2).<br>
Next off, choose a trendy color of grey (ideally blue-gray because you are utilizing black, not dark brown). Pick the location where you see the most intense coverage of that shade. Put one layer of the light thickness gray fill down starting on its best edge of where it is most extreme, prolonging it to the edge of the 2nd layer of black (Figure 3), after that include a second layer of grey, prolonging it to cover both layers of black and also extending right into the facility of the ball (Figure 4).<br>
Concentrate on the lightest area of the sphere. Similar to the various other two colors, position a light thickness fill over the most intense location of the white to make sure that it hardly touches the side of the tool grey and also reaches the side of the circle (Figure 5). Next, add a second layer of the light density white fill. This moment, cover the original area of white and prolong the new team of stitches to the side of the first grey layer (Figure 6).<br>
Last but not least, cover both layers of white, this time extending the fill to the edge of the underlying black layer. Turn off your grey completes order to see the edge of the black (Figure 7). You will now have three layers of the 30% fill covering the sphere.<br>
FULL-COLOR SHADING<br>
Now, allow's check out exactly how to color a totally tinted item. A three-dimensional apple is a perfect instance due to the fact that it will certainly strengthen what you found out in shading the ball.<br>
A dark red shade is made use of to define the edges of the apple, while a lighter color is utilized to bring the facility of the apple ahead. As well as, since the apple is a difficult glossy item, the comparison goes from extremely dark to really light, with intense patches of white where the light strikes it.<br>
The shade wheel contains a development from red to yellow (" cozy" colors) on one side and also a progression from blue to purple (" cool" shades) on the other side. For the apple, when we choose the shade of thread to specify the outdoors, we will make use of maroon, a shade that combines red with among our great colors, blue. For the warm colors in the center of the apple, we will certainly use orange, the warm color of red.<br>
In Figure 8, notice how we lay out the apple with maroon, after that develop the layers by covering the a lot more intense areas of maroon initially. After that, we go back and expand the shade right into the center.<br>
Additionally, notification there is much less maroon on the right side of the apple than on the left. This is since the brighter side is obtaining the most light. Seeing the instructions of the light will aid you to expect where to position your shades, along with the quantity of each color to use.<br>
Likewise, you can see that we have extended maroon up into the stem and leaf. Later, we will place green over the maroon, which will give the illusion of brownish and help specify the center of the leaf.<br>
The following color in the apple is red. This covers part of the maroon as you sew the first layer, after that includes the side with the second layer. You likewise will certainly expand this color into the center of the apple, while leaving room for the orange layer that will certainly be put on top of the red to give it the cozy cast. (Figure 9).<br>
In Figure 10, orange and light yellow highlights have been added, with just a touch of white ahead. You might be asking yourself why the light yellow was picked. This was since we required a progressive transition from orange to white.<br>
In Figure 11, environment-friendly has actually been included, starting with a lighter eco-friendly that enables the maroon layers to reveal through the light fill. Where we wanted a pure color of that color, a second layer was contributed to raise thickness.<br>
A darker green additionally is added for definition and also to enhance shielding with only one layer of the light fill. Right here, a running stitch is utilized to offer the fallen leave detail. You can see it a lot more plainly by using the running stitch at an angle opposite the underlying fill stitches. If they had been used at the exact same angle as the underlying fill, they would sink in, be practically undetected and also, as a matter of fact, blend. There is a light layer of the original red that blends the body of the apple with each other.<br>
To tidy up the sides, a single line of maroon stitching is used around the whole apple. This can be a replication of the first synopsis. You will find, once again, that there is no distortion when you layer your design with this light density fill. That last running stitch synopsis will certainly align perfectly.<br>
